TikTok plans to restrict video viewing for users under the age of 18

Chinese short video service TikTok has announced that it will restrict video viewing for users under the age of 18, writes Life.ru with reference to a statement from the company.

The restriction will operate in such a way that after 60 minutes of viewing, you will need to enter a passcode on the device in order to continue browsing. It will be possible to completely disable this feature only with the consent of the parents.

It is considered that this will provide a kind of barrier to endless scrolling and will protect the digital well-being of young audiences.

“In the coming weeks, every TikTok user under the age of 18 will automatically be subject to a 60-minute daily screen time limit. Teenagers who reach this limit will be prompted to enter a passcode to continue browsing. They can disable the feature entirely, but if they do so and spend more than 100 minutes a day on TikTok, they will be asked to set a new limit”, - the statement said.

TikTok has also updated its Family Pairing feature, which permits parents to link their account to their children's account and set controls to filter videos and set their own schedules for the service.

TikTok is a social network where users create and watch short videos. The service is owned by Beijing-based “ByteDance”.
